  • In the case of Zilmax, a growth-promoter that was removed from the marketplace in 2013 due to animal safety concerns, the Food & Water Watch report found that there had been virtually no independent, peer-reviewed studies into the safety of the drug for cattle. (commondreams.org)
  • But a new report from Food & Water Watch charges the industry with playing an enormous and hard-to-track role in the production of such studies. (commondreams.org)

  • Protein binding studies , carried out during the early stage of drug development, are a major part of the preclinical process. (marketsandmarkets.com)
  • The discovery and development of a drug is a very cost-intensive process as it requires major investments in terms of capital, human resources, and technological expertise. (marketsandmarkets.com)
  • Thus, to avoid such late-stage attritions in drug development, pharmaceutical companies are investing extensively in early stage, preclinical testing methods. (marketsandmarkets.com)

  • Clinical drug development is a complex, slow, and laborious process. (amazon.com)
  • According to Tufts Center for the Study of Drug Development , it takes an average of 7 to 10 years and more than $2.5 billion to bring a new drug to market. (amazon.com)
  • Drug development programs fail for a host of reasons , including flawed study design, failure to recruit enough s, and high participant drop-out rates. (amazon.com)

  • Like many other elderly people, she takes multiple prescription drugs for several conditions, including high blood pressure, elevated cholesterol and glaucoma. (cnn.com)
  • On average, name-brand prescription drugs in Canada cost an estimated 40% less than they do in the U.S. (cnn.com)
  • Yet what Clark and others are doing is technically illegal, since the U.S. forbids the import of prescription drugs by anyone other than the original U.S. manufacturer, and even then only when the drugs meet all the approval requirements of the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A). (cnn.com)
  • The FDA contends it is looking out for consumer safety, but in fact a growing volume of prescription drugs sold in the U.S. is made overseas and brought in by domestic manufacturers. (cnn.com)
  • It has a powerful partner in the FDA, which over the past year has conducted widely publicized seizures of prescription drugs shipped into the U.S. from Canada, Mexico and elsewhere that it maintains could be harmful to consumers. (cnn.com)

  • CHICAGO (AP) - Almost one-third of new drugs approved by U.S. regulators over a decade ended up years later with warnings about unexpected, sometimes life-threatening side effects or complications, a new analysis found. (hightimes.com)
  • 1. Anti Malarial Drug analysis predicts the representation of this market, supply and demand, capacity, detailed investigations, etc. (bharatbook.com)
  • Only 40% of a set of drugs granted accelerated approvals in the United States and 39% of those given similar speedy clearances in the European Union had 'high added' therapeutic value, in an analysis reported by Thomas J. Hwang, MD, of Harvard Medical School and co-authors in JAMA Health Forum . (medscape.com)
  • Specialty drugs are costly because drug companies set a price that yields what they view as a necessary profit margin. (rand.org)
  • The law eased the path to approval for drugs that treated so-called orphan conditions and offered sizable tax credits to companies making the necessary investment. (rand.org)
  • Our interviews with drug developers indicate that the price of a drug at launch is determined strategically: basically drug companies consider what the market will bear. (rand.org)
  • Companies think about the potential revenue from a drug over its life cycle, including the period of market exclusivity for the orphan condition. (rand.org)
